[p]After their glorious Champions League campaign last year, where they reached the round of 16 before crashing out against [a href="https://www.flashscore.ca/team/sporting-cp/tljXuHBC/"]Sporting CP[/a], [a href="https://www.flashscore.ca/team/bodo-glimt/S0WZMUNG/"]Bodo/Glimt[/a] now takes the first step in building for the future, as construction has begun for the "Arctic Arena," set to hold 10,000 spectators and designed to meet UEFA requirements.[/p][p]The stadium is set to be completed in 2027, as the project represents one of the most important investments ever made in the development of Bodo/Glimt is a major step forward for football, community, and business in Northern Norway.[/p][embed guid="df5739be-9e4f-485c-ad4c-b10ad2306289" url="https://x.com/fcbusiness/status/2057072690544943152" social-type="twitter" /][p]Bodo/Glimt enjoyed a remarkable UEFA Champions League campaign, reaching the Round of 16 for the first time in the club’s history in its first-ever participation in the competition, with the football world stunned by the extraordinary rise of a club from north of the Arctic Circle.[/p][p][b]“This is a defining moment for Bodø/Glimt, for our supporters and for the whole region,”[/b] said Frode Thomassen, CEO of Bodo/Glimt.[/p][p]“The start of construction of our new arena is much more than the beginning of a building project. It is a statement about who we are, what we have built together, and where we want to go. This arena will be the future home of Bodo/Glimt and a place that reflects the ambition, energy and unity that have driven this club’s remarkable journey.”[/p]
Bodo/Glimt launch construction of new arena as Champions League surprise builds for future
Bodø/Glimt has officially marked the start of construction of the “Arctic Arena”, a landmark project that will become the future home of the four-time Norwegian champions and a symbol of the club’s continued growth on and off the pitch.
